First step was to stamp the Hat & Boots (E829) several times with Memento Tuxedo Black ink on Kraft cardstock. I then pulled out my Copic Markers to color each piece, fussy cut them out, and layer it back together with 3D Foam Squares and Mini Glue Dots. I wanted to create a 3D effect with the Hat & Boots. It's a little hard to tell in the photo's but it looks truly awesome in person.
I pulled the colors from the boots for the background, including the faux stitching around the edges, added some distress ink around the image, and incorporated some wood DP.
